Method
Cheese Blend
- 1
Prepare cheeses
If not pre-shredded, grate or shred the mozzarella, cheddar, and optional fontina/provolone on the medium side of a box grater or with the grater disk of a food processor so the pieces are similar size for even melting.
- 2
Toss with cornstarch
Place all shredded cheeses and the grated Parmesan in a large bowl. Sprinkle the cornstarch over the cheeses and toss thoroughly with clean hands or two forks until evenly coated. The cornstarch helps prevent clumping and yields a smoother melt.
- 3
Season
Add sea salt, black pepper, and garlic powder (if using) to the cheese mixture and toss again to distribute evenly.
Application & Finish
- 4
Use immediately or store
For immediate use: sprinkle the cheese blend liberally over your dish (pizza, pasta, baked casserole, nachos, garlic bread, etc.) in an even layer. For a deeper golden crust, broil for 2–4 minutes on high, watching closely to avoid burning. For a gooey melt without browning, bake at the recipe's temperature until cheese is fully melted (typically 5–10 minutes at 350–425°F depending on dish).
- 5
Garnish
If desired, sprinkle the chopped parsley over the melted cheese just before serving for color and a fresh note.
- 6
Storage
To store unused blend: transfer to an airtight container or zip-top bag, press out excess air, and refrigerate up to 5 days. Shake or toss before using. For longer storage, freeze flat in a sealed bag up to 3 months; thaw in refrigerator before using.
